Diabetics too should best try and avoid this fruit, due to its high carb count. While small quantities can be beneficial in meeting fiber requirements, excess of it might cause weight gain because of its high carbs. Weight watchers can include this fruit in moderation in their diet, but without peeling it as much of the fiber lies just beneath its skin. Chickoo is a very healthy fruit when we talk about gut health. The high fiber in it helps to keep the gut clean, avoid constipation and boost metabolism.
